Quick Answer:A full-time he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anic and installer in Pasadena, CA earns a median $69,284/year (≈ $33.31/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 49-9021). Once you factor in Pasadena's price level (13% above national, BEA RPP 113.1), that paycheck buys what $61,259 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 0.8% above the California state average.

YearAnnual SalaryStatus
2019$53,303Actual
2020$55,337Actual
2021$53,193Actual
2022$56,212Actual
2023$62,677Actual
2024$77,500Actual
2025$66,735Actual
2026(current)$69,284Estimated
2027$71,931Projected

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Pasadena metropolitan area, the median he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anic and installer salary grew 25.2% from $53,303 (2019) to $66,735 (2025). At a 3.82%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$71,931 by 2027 — a total increase of $18,628 (34.95%) from 2019.

Note: Historical values (20192025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Pasadena met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 20262026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.82%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anic and Installer Job Market in Pasadena

A local job market with 35 he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anics and installers indicates a niche but steady demand for skilled professionals in Pasadena. Notably, the cost of living index stands at 113.1, which slightly increases the pressure on salaries to match living expenses. Employers like One Hour Heating & Air and ARS / Rescue Rooter often offer competitive wages, especially for those with specialized skills in commercial HVAC or data center operations. The pay disparity between lower and higher earners can be partly explained by the complexity of the job, with specialties in areas like data center precision cooling commanding higher rates. Furthermore, commissions and spiffs at residential service companies can create substantial earning potential, especially during peak residential demand driven by factors like IRA tax credits for heat pump installations. For those seeking to maximize earnings, honing skills in emerging technologies—such as advanced refrigerants—and obtaining certifications like NATE or a state contractor license can significantly enhance marketability and pay opportunities in this evolving Pasadena market.
